Factors to Consider When Choosing an Extra Wide Tattoo Armrest
When choosing an extra wide tattoo armrest, you should consider several key factors. Think about the size and dimensions that best fit your workspace, as well as the material quality for durability and comfort. Don’t forget to assess features like adjustability, stability, and ease of cleaning to guarantee you get the best option for your needs.
Size and Dimensions
Choosing the right size and dimensions for an extra wide tattoo armrest is vital for both client comfort and artist efficiency. Aim for a panel size of at least 23.6 inches by 15.6 inches to guarantee ample space for your client. Height adjustment is important, so look for a range between 26 to 40 inches to accommodate different seating preferences. A wider armrest, like 27.5 inches by 12.6 inches, can support arms, legs, or feet, adding versatility. Don’t forget about padding; opt for thickness around 2.4 to 2.7 inches for comfort during long sessions. Finally, choose an armrest with a sturdy base to support these larger dimensions, assuring stability and preventing movement during procedures.
Material Quality
Selecting the right size and dimensions for your extra wide tattoo armrest sets the stage for comfort and efficiency, but material quality plays a vital role in the overall experience. High-quality PU leather and high-density sponge are ideal for their softness and waterproof properties, ensuring comfort during long sessions. Look for wear-resistant, non-slip materials to maintain stability and precision while you work. An armrest with removable covers or easy-to-clean surfaces enhances hygiene, which is essential in professional settings. Opt for a metal frame over plastic for better stability, as plastic can bend or break. Finally, reinforced seams and stitching prevent premature wear, keeping your armrest functional and visually appealing for years to come.
Adjustability Features
Adjustability features are essential in guaranteeing both you and your clients experience comfort and ease during tattoo sessions. Look for armrests that offer a height adjustable range, typically between 24 to 40 inches, to suit different client heights and your own preferences. Models with angle adjustments, like a 180-degree tilt or 360-degree rotation, let you find the perfect position for intricate work. Confirm the armrest supports various body parts, with features catering to arms, hands, and legs. Evaluate the ease of adjustment; options with foot pedals or screw mechanisms allow for quick height changes. Finally, choose armrests with secure locking mechanisms to prevent unwanted movement during those detailed tattoo sessions. Comfort and precision go hand in hand!
Stability and Support
While comfort is paramount during tattoo sessions, stability and support in an extra wide tattoo armrest are just as critical. You want an armrest that prevents wobbling or movement, guaranteeing precision for both you and your client. Look for solid construction with high-quality metal frames and reinforced designs to enhance load-bearing capacity. Features like anti-slip pads on the base help maintain grip on various surfaces, reducing the risk of shifting. An H-type or four-corner base design offers better support and even weight distribution, minimizing tipping risks. Finally, verify regular testing for durability and stability so your armrest can withstand the demands of extensive use in a professional setting. Your clients deserve the best experience possible!
Ease of Cleaning
When you’re choosing an extra wide tattoo armrest, ease of cleaning should be a top priority. Opt for armrests made from PU leather or similar materials, as they’re smooth, waterproof, and easy to wipe down after use. Look for options with removable covers; these can be cleaned or replaced effortlessly, ensuring hygiene. Anti-slip surfaces are a bonus, providing stability while simplifying the cleaning process by preventing debris buildup. Also, consider armrests with minimal seams and crevices, as these areas can trap dirt and bacteria, making maintenance harder. Finally, choose materials that resist stains and abrasion, promoting longevity and making upkeep a breeze. Keeping your workspace clean is essential for both you and your clients.
